JOB DESCRIPTION
Summary/Objective
The role is responsible for managing the assigned Climbing Kites territory, working closely with the Regional Distribution Manager, wholesalers, and their sales teams to drive sales, strengthen the Climbing Kites brand, and meet distribution and volume targets. The position also involves building and maintaining professional relationships with key retailers and distributors to ensure ongoing growth and success in the market.
Essential Functions
Upholds Climbing Kites’ Core Values, Purpose, and Philosophies in all actions and decisions.
- Fosters strong communication and maintains positive relationships with the Regional Distribution Manager, wholesaler sales teams, and key retail partners.
- Develops and manages quarterly target lists aligned with sales goals and objectives.
- Completes scheduled “work withs” alongside the Climbing Kites team and wholesaler partners.
- Actively participates in strategic market initiatives to support sales to key retailers within the assigned territory.
- Analyzes sales opportunities using VIP software or other provided sales tools to identify growth potential.
- Delivers continuous brand training to retail partners, distributors, and consumers.
- Assists with special events and festivals within the territory to enhance brand visibility.
- Handles administrative duties, including but not limited to expense budgets and reports, monthly work calendar, setting distribution targets, evaluating discount programs, and conducting price surveys.
- Maintains a professional image and conduct at all times, representing the brand.

Qualifications
Reside within the designated market area for which the Field Sales Manager is responsible.
- Possess a reliable vehicle and a valid driver’s license.
- Flexibility to work a varied schedule, including nights and weekends, as needed.
- Minimum of two years of experience in the consumer packaged goods (CPG) sector, with a preference for experience with beverage wholesalers or suppliers.
- Strong understanding of the craft beer industry, market trends, and retail consumer behavior.
-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ite and/or Google Workspace.
- Confident in public speaking and able to deliver engaging presentations.
Willingness and ability to travel as required.
